#0bbc04 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0bbc04 is composed of 4.3% red, 73.7%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 94.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 26.3% black. It has a hue angle of 117.7 degrees, a saturation of 95.8% and a lightness of 37.6%. #0bbc04 color hex could be obtained by blending #16ff08 with #007900. Closest websafe color is: #00cc00.

#0bbc04 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0bbc04 has RGB values of R:11, G:188,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.94,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 769028.

Shades and Tints of #0bbc04
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010f00 is the darkest color, while #fbfffb is the lightest one.
